A dental crown serves both cosmetic and restorative purposes in dentistry. Here are five ways crowns can be used to renew your smile:
- Repair Damaged Teeth
Although your teeth are quite strong, they’re not unbreakable. Dental trauma, such as biting down forcefully on hard food, can result in a chipped or cracked tooth. A damaged tooth is more susceptible to infection and decay, making your problem even worse. Through dental crown treatment, Dr. Puri can repair the damage and protect your tooth from further harm. Crowning a damaged tooth restores its strength, health, and functionality for the future.
- Curtail Enamel Erosion
Your tooth’s enamel (outer layer) protects the dentin and pulp within, which contains your tooth’s blood vessels and nerves. Enamel erosion weakens your tooth, making it more prone to sensitivity, oral infection, and breakage. Tooth enamel doesn’t grow back once it’s gone, but worn enamel can be replaced with a dental crown. Dr. Puri may recommend crowning weak or worn teeth as a preventive measure against dental issues or damage in the future.
- Treat Advanced Tooth Decay
Most cavities can be treated with dental fillings. If the problem is severe, however, a filling alone may not provide the protection your tooth needs to survive. Depending on the extent of decay, Dr. Puri may crown your tooth in addition to or as a replacement for a filling after having the decay removed. A crown will not only seal out bacteria that can cause future infection but will also reinforce your tooth’s vulnerable structure to keep it from fracturing or crumbling with continued use.
- Restore Your Smile’s Appearance
Porcelain crowns look and feel like real teeth. They’re custom-made in a lab to match your natural teeth perfectly. A crown will naturally restore your compromised tooth’s shape, structure, and natural color to give your smile a whole, healthy-looking appearance. Dental crowns can also improve the size, shape, or color of mismatched teeth to enhance your smile’s aesthetics.
- Prevent Tooth Loss
Like most dentists, Dr. Puri prefers to restore a damaged tooth rather than have it removed. If your tooth can be saved with a crown, we’ll recommend this treatment. Crowning compromised teeth prevents premature tooth loss and helps preserve your smile for the future.
